We need an independent candidate in Southwest Georgia
Last Tuesday, Democratic voters in nine southwest Georgia counties filled out their ballots in the party’s primary, selecting nominees for U.S. Senate, Congress and various local races. Any votes they cast for a man named James Williams, however, were not counted. That’s because Williams, the only Democratic candidate for state House District 151, was officially thrown off the ballot earlier this month following a challenge by his opponent, incumbent Republican state Representative Gerald Greene (R-Cuthbert).
